On Tuesday 12 May 2009 14:33:00 Martin Badie wrote:
> Hi,
>
> I have mounted an NFS share like:
>
> mount_nfs -LisT 10.10.10.199:/vol/share   /mnt
>
> but I can't use -LisT on fstab because man mount_nfs states:

Yes you can. Just comma seperate the arguments without whitespace in the 
appropreate column. The only thing you cannot do in fstab(5) is use arguments 
containing whitespace, like mounting your music collection on My Music folder.
